We’ve got some press coverage!! 🎉🎉
Thank you to New Jersey Stage [ New Jersey Stage ] for covering the launch of The NEW YORK / ASBURY PARK Music Exchange [ NY / Asbury Park Music Exchange ] in last week’s edition of their online magazine!! 💥🎸
Following our very first event last week at Cowgirl Seahorse [ Cowgirl Seahorse ] in NY, which featured two bands from NY and two bands from Asbury Park, the magazine published this interview with Exchange founders, NY musician Phil Robinson [ Phil Robinson ] and Asbury Park musician Brian Erickson [ Brian Erickson ]. 🔥🔥
In the interview, Phil & Brian discuss the origins of the Exchange, its ongoing goals, and some of their perspectives navigating the music scenes across both cities. 🎶🎵

Directions to Front Street in New York can be reached through public transport by taking the subway train number 2 or 3 to Wall Street Station. From the station, you can walk towards Front Street where the restaurant is located.
If you are driving from Manhattan using FDR Drive, take exit 3 on South Street and take a right turn to John Street. Take another right turn when you reach Front Street and continue driving until you reach the destination.
Parking is limited along Front Street, but there are a few parking lots nearby for those who opt to drive. Be sure to check their rates and hours of operation before parking your car.
